What is a copay in health insurance?

In health insurance, a copay, also known as a copayment, is a fixed amount you pay for covered healthcare services, like doctor visits or prescriptions. What is a deductible in health insurance?

Imagine health insurance as a financial shield protecting you from high medical bills. However, this shield doesn’t kick in immediately. You have to pay a certain amount upfront before your insurance starts sharing the costs. This initial amount you pay is called the deductible. Think of it like a car insurance deductible.
